Extended Description

Phoronix ran some benchmarks with Clang 9/10 and GCC 9/10 on AMD. The article shows significant performance regressions in multiple benchmarks.

https://www.phoronix.com/scan.php?page=article&item=gcc-clang-3960x&num=2

This is unlikely to be AMD specific, at the very least it'll probably affect all Haswell-class (AVX2) CPUs - the article says as much:

"unfortunately the release build of LLVM Clang Git was pointing to performance regressions compared to LLVM Clang 9.0 stable. We've also seen Clang 10 running slower than Clang 9 on other systems and will have those additional results out in the coming days."

Is anyone setup with a suitable machine to run a git bisect script to track the regression(s) down?
